Lizzie Page is a bestselling author of historical fiction, known for stories featuring women struggling and triumphing against the odds. Born and raised in Essex, England, she studied politics at university and worked as an English teacher in Paris and Tokyo before earning a master's degree in creative writing at Goldsmiths College. She lives in a seaside town in Essex with her husband, three children, and their dog.
